What Makes an Ice Fishing Game Appealing?
The popularity of ice fishing games stems from their ability to replicate the core elements that make the real-life experience so enjoyable. The anticipation of the bite, the strategic selection of bait, the careful management of equipment – all these can be faithfully recreated in a digital format. However, successful games go beyond mere replication; they add layers of complexity and challenge that can appeal to a broad audience. This includes realistic fish behavior, dynamic weather conditions, and a progression system that rewards skill and persistence. The accessibility of these games is also a significant draw. No expensive gear, freezing temperatures, or travel time are required – just a computer or mobile device and an internet connection.
Many ice fishing game online options focus on the simulation aspect, aiming to provide a lifelike experience. They often feature detailed graphics, accurate fish species, and realistic ice environments. Others lean more towards arcade-style gameplay, emphasizing fast-paced action and competitive leaderboards. The best games strike a balance between realism and entertainment, providing a challenging yet rewarding experience for players of all skill levels.
Furthermore, the social aspect shouldn’t be overlooked. Many online ice fishing games allow players to compete against each other, share tips and strategies, and even collaborate on fishing expeditions. This fosters a sense of community and camaraderie, enhancing the overall gaming experience.

The Variety of Online Ice Fishing Experiences
The ice fishing game online landscape is surprisingly diverse. From mobile apps to full-fledged PC simulations, there’s a game to suit every preference and platform. Some games focus on a single aspect of ice fishing, such as jigging for specific species, while others offer a more comprehensive experience, including setting up tip-ups, managing inventory, and even building and customizing your own ice shack. The level of realism also varies significantly. Some games prioritize graphical fidelity and accurate physics, while others opt for a more cartoonish and simplified aesthetic.
Mobile games often emphasize accessibility and quick gameplay sessions, making them ideal for casual players. PC simulations, on the other hand, tend to be more complex and immersive, catering to those who want a truly authentic ice fishing experience. It’s important to research different options and read reviews to find a game that aligns with your interests and gaming style.
Beyond the core gameplay mechanics, many games incorporate additional features, such as fishing tournaments, daily challenges, and seasonal events. These elements help to keep the game fresh and engaging, encouraging players to return for more.
Popular Game Mechanics
A common element across many successful ice fishing games is the emphasis on skill-based gameplay. Simply casting a line and waiting for a bite isn’t enough; players need to master various techniques, such as jigging, setting the right hook, and managing their line tension. These mechanics require practice and precision, adding a layer of depth and challenge to the experience. Understanding fish behavior is also crucial. Different species respond to different baits and techniques, and knowing when and where to fish can significantly improve your chances of success.
Progression systems are another key component. Players typically start with basic gear and limited access to fishing locations. As they gain experience and earn rewards, they can unlock new equipment, upgrade their existing gear, and explore more challenging environments. This provides a sense of accomplishment and motivates players to continue fishing.
Many online titles incorporate a robust economic system, allowing players to buy, sell, and trade resources with each other. This adds a social and strategic dimension to the game, encouraging players to interact and cooperate.

Free-to-Play vs. Paid Games
The world of online ice fishing games encompasses both free-to-play and paid options. Free-to-play games are often supported by in-app purchases, allowing players to spend real money on items that enhance their gameplay experience. While these games can be a good option for casual players, they often come with limitations or restrictions that can impact the overall experience.
Paid games typically offer more comprehensive features and a more balanced gameplay experience. They also tend to be free of intrusive advertisements and microtransactions. However, they require an upfront investment, which may not be appealing to everyone.
Ultimately, the best choice depends on your individual preferences and budget. Consider what’s important to you in a game and choose an option that aligns with your needs.
